Essentially speaking, Day trading involves the purchase and sale of securities like stocks or bonds within a single day. Therefore, all positions need to be closed before the end of the trading day.

This means that day traders typically do not keep financial securities post trading hours. Done properly, it’s possible to turn a tidy profit, but the risk associated with it is high.

Its fast-paced nature can result in big profits or substantial losses. Thus, day trading isn't recommended for all. It necessitates a intense understanding of market trends and discipline in trading.

Day traders use several techniques, including scalping, where they try to capture small profits by selling stocks within minutes after purchase. One other commonly used technique is certainly swing trading: where traders aim to gain profits from a stock within one to four days.

A high degree of knowledge, experience and time is needed in day trading. You must be able to watch the market closely and react instantly on the data you gather.

It is indeed a high-pressure and high-stakes career. But for people who have the skills and temperament, it can be a rewarding profession within the finance industry.
